Foster care and adoption in the age of COVID-19

As a parent—or aspiring parent—you’re already dealing with uncertainty every day. The last thing you needed was to have caseworkers become more difficult to reach or to have the routines you’ve worked so hard to establish unravel as schools close and providers become overwhelmed.

It’s an ever-changing landscape, but the reality is that wherever you are in your adoption journey, everything is most likely going to take longer as workers and resources are focused on keeping kids safe. Patience has always been an important quality in people who foster and adopt, and that is doubly true today.
